Kittanning is a locality in Armstrong County, Pennsylvania, United States. It has a population of approximately 3,902. The population density is 1515.2 people per km². Kittanning is located at 40.8165°N, 79.5220°W. It observes the Eastern Time (America/New_York) timezone. ZIP code: 16201.
Kittanning sprawls with a quiet dignity along the wide, curving embrace of the Allegheny River. It lies 24.9 miles north-north-east of Plum, PA (from Plum, PA: bearing 29°T), and is situated 3.1 miles north of Ford City. The history of Kittanning is deeply interwoven with the natural resources that have shaped its character and economy. Once a hub for the timber and coal industries, the echoes of those days can still be felt in the sturdy, weathered architecture and the very contours of the land, subtly altered by past endeavors. The river was, and remains, a vital corridor, facilitating trade and connection. While the dominant industries have shifted, a resilient spirit persists, evident in the local shops lining the streets and the close-knit feel of the neighborhoods. Even now, the passage of barges on the Allegheny offers a tangible link to a long industrial heritage, a reminder of the powerful forces that have drawn people to this particular bend in the river.
